On my Windows2000 Professional machine, when I go to Control Panel/Administrative Tool/there is no items. on the lift side of the screen it saya " There are no items to show in this folder" what is wrong? how can I fix this?

Sounds like the links were deleted, copy from another machine.

I manage a lot of servers with terminal services sessions and I find that some of the machines have had their tools made "invisible" through recycling of bits. I copied the links to a path and just \\server\me\admintools\ to get the tools I need.

It is unfortunate that some of the links no longer tell you where the executable file is they are pointing to. The "target" shows the program name. Makes it harder to find the specific .exe or .msc file to click on.

Try (at command line):

sfc /scannow

This may prompt you for the original installation disk. However, I've found this to be a quick fix for things of this sort. Good luck!
